Outer Tie Rod Ends

I'm in need to replace my outer tie rod ends and notice a few sites stated "if built before 8/16/99 use this one, built after 8/16/99 use this. What was the change and how can I decode the VIN to know what I have? Is there a visual differances?

Should I take the chance to order the cheapest or just go for OEM

Wink 9&10 digit

RickH,Mike here.Welcome to the forum.If you will count the digits in your vin.# according to Polaris the 9th digit is the (month) and the 10th digit is the (year).Hope this helps,Mike

doesnt really matter i had the old style on my scrambler and just switched it over this weekend to the new style with no problems got a kit from quadboss.com came with inner and outer tie rod ends for both sides cost about 60.00
